A beautifully appointed self-catering holiday cottage located in the centre of picturesque Mousehole in Cornwall. Mole Cottage has superb sea views across Mount's Bay and is within easy walking distance of excellent local restaurants and cafes. The cottage is 4 star quality graded and is working towards an award for green tourism. Mole cottage sleeps up to 3 people in one double bedroom and one single bedroom. We can also provide a travel cot and high chair if required. High quality furnishings and appliances include digital TV, DVD player and hi-fi system in the sitting room. The oak kitchen has ceramic hob, electric oven, dishwasher, washer-dryer and microwave oven. A welcome tray is provided for your arrival so that you can begin to relax straight away. Bed linen is provided and beds made up for your arrival. The cottage is ideally suited to couples and small families and is very popular for special occasions such as honeymoons and anniversaries. Mousehole is the perfect location for a relaxing holiday in Cornwall. The village has a number of fantastic restaurants, shops and galleries. Within easy reach are Newlyn and Penzance and attractions such as The Eden Project, The Lost Gardens of Heligan, Truro, Glendurgan, Trebah, St Michael's Mount, St Ives and Tate St Ives. The nearest train station is found at Penzance with regular services to St Ives and Truro. There is an excellent bus service from Mousehole to Penzance with half-hourly buses most days. Mousehole is famous for its Christmas Lights which are switched on every year in mid-December. During this time, Tom Bawcock's Eve is celebrated (23rd December) with a lamp-lit procession through the village streets and ends with everyone sharing Star Gazey pie in The Ship Inn. There is also an annual Carnival in August and a biennial festival called Sea Salts & Sail.
